Задать вопрос
nazartropanets
@nazartropanets
изучаю deep learning и ML(Python)

POST запросы через Selenium?

Задача такова - через Selenium я должен заходить на сайт и проходить капчу а потом уже парсер должен отправлять POST запрос, но в Selenium нельзя отправлять post запросы. Что я должен изпользовать для этой задачи?
  • Вопрос задан
  • 5713 просмотров
Подписаться 1 Простой Комментировать
Решения вопроса 2
kshnkvn
@kshnkvn
yay ✌️ t.me/kshnkvn
@Andrey_Dolg
На странице selenium позволяет исполнять JavaScript. Всё что вам надо это составить правильный запрос и выполнить этот JS код. Если удобней можете так же загрузить одну из JS библиотек для этого.
Но как и написал человек выше вы можете послать запрос с помощью других библиотек если правильно их составите.
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
Селениум никогда никакой POST запрос никуда не посылает. Вы смешали яблоки с грушами.

Селениум управляет браузером. Если вам надо открыть страницу с помощью POST запроса, создайте форму, откройте форму и только потом через селениум.

Далее можно залить кусок JS кода в браузер, который создаст форму за вас, и откроет её.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ы